Is ml in 8 oz of flour the same?
No, ml in 8 oz of flour is not the same as ml in 8 oz of liquid. While an 8-ounce liquid is equal to 236.588 milliliters (mL), a dry ingredient like flour does not have a fixed conversion from ounces to milliliters due to its density. Therefore, it’s best to refer to a kitchen scale for measuring flour.
